‖Pseu′dæs‐the″si‐a (?), n. [NL. See Pseudo-, and Æsthesia.] (Physiol.) False or imaginary feeling or sense perception such as occurs in hypochondriasis, or such as is referred to an organ that has been removed, as an amputated foot.
